Last May, two students of the double degree in Law and Droit UAB-University of Toulouse Capitole 1, Clàudia Fleta Ib'ez and Elia Valpuesta Alda participated in the Inter-American Human Rights Moot Court Competition that took place at the American University Washington College of Law, in Washington DC.

 The contest consisted of a trial simulation before the Inter-American Court of Human Rights. The students, representatives of a fictitious state accused of having violated the rights of one of its citizens, reached the semifinal and Clàudia Fleta was distinguished as the second best speaker of the representatives of the States.
